Big US vulnerability! China’s strict export control on a rare earth mineral has given America a headache - how will it make missiles, fighter jets?
Posted
China's dominance in rare earth minerals, particularly samarium, poses a significant challenge to the US and its allies in replenishing military equipment. Export restrictions on these materials, vital for defence applications, are impacting weapon production. Despite ongoing trade negotiations, China is unlikely to ease these restrictions.
